Our school-wide theme for this year is דביקות/קדושה. This refers to the ways that the presence of G-d in our lives shapes the way that we live, the choices that we make and the expectations that we have. As a Modern Orthodox school, SAR strives to maintain and develop a unique balance of commitment to Torah and mitzvot with a confident and embracing openness to the world. Striking that balance demands inspiration as well as constant reflection. This year’s honorees are individuals who understand and exemplify this ideal, having committed their lives to תורה ומדע.
